A Digital Pilgrimage Through the Japanese Alps
The sheer ambition of Forza Horizon 6 is evident in its approach to geography. We aren’t just looking at a few city streets. the preview describes a breathtaking journey through rural Japan and the Japanese Alps. The intro sequence sets a high bar, featuring the 2025 GR GT Prototype tearing through the landscape and skidding up to a live rocket launch. It’s the kind of high-octane spectacle the series is known for, but there is a deeper intent here. Design Director Torben Ellert has noted that the goal was to make the Horizon Festival feel like a part of Japan rather than something dominating it.

This “tourism” angle is a clever narrative pivot. Instead of being dropped in as an established superstar, players enter the world as festival tourists visiting on a whim with friends. It’s a grounded way to introduce the mechanics, serving as a tutorial while players qualify for the Invitational. By framing the experience as tourism, the developers give players “permission” to simply exist in the space, exploring the intricacies of the map without the immediate pressure of the professional circuit. To ensure this feels authentic, the production has involved Japanese artists from various fields, moving beyond mere aesthetics to capture the actual soul of the culture.
The Technical Hurdle: 60 FPS and the 550-Car Garage
For the hardware enthusiasts and sim-racers frequenting the tech hubs around the University of Washington, the technical specifications are where the real conversation begins. The preview build was locked to a 30 FPS “Quality” mode, but the promise of a 60 FPS “Performance” mode at launch is the critical detail. In a game where you’re barrelling through mountain passes at breakneck speeds, that frame rate difference is the gap between a smooth ride and a jarring experience. If you’ve been following modern gaming hardware trends, you know that pushing a meticulously modeled open world at 60 FPS requires serious GPU overhead.
Then there is the scale of the content. Day one will feature a staggering 550 cars. This isn’t just about variety; it’s about the nuance of how each vehicle responds to the specific Japanese environment. Whether it’s the grip on a winding alpine road or the aerodynamics of the GR GT Prototype, the interplay between the vehicle physics and the terrain is what transforms a driving game into a simulation. The “seamless” nature of the races and events further removes the friction, allowing the open world to feel like one continuous, living entity rather than a series of loading screens and menus.
